At Fairview Hospital, we know all about the joys and anxieties of pregnancy, birth and parenting. After all, we help over 4,000 expectant families bring their babies into the world each year. We know our patients have many questions and concerns, and we are prepared to help in every way. From the time expected mothers learn about their pregnancy, the physicians and staff of Fairview Hospital will be working to make the experience healthy, pleasant and memorable.


Cleveland Clinic Fairview Hospital’s Family Birth Place/LDRP nursing unit encompasses six labor/delivery/recovery/postpartum rooms and three private inpatient rooms. Part of Fairview’s birthing services, which delivers approximately 5,000 babies each year, our dedicated, talented nursing caregivers offer 24/7 obstetrical and newborn care. A caregiver who excels in this role will:

  • Provide direct nursing care.

  • Implement, monitor, evaluate, update and revise patient care plans.

  • Monitor, record, document and communicate patients’ conditions.

  • Administer prescribed medications and treatments.

  • Note and carry out physician and nursing orders.

  • Assess and coordinate patients’ discharge needs.

  • Educate patients and their families.



Minimum qualifications for the ideal future caregiver include:

  • Graduate from an accredited school of professional nursing

  • Current state licensure as a Registered Nurse (RN)

  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ification through the American Heart Association (AHA)

  • One year of current acute care RN experience. Will consider military RN experience



Preferred qualifications for the ideal future caregiver include:

  • Bachelor’s of Science in Nursing (BSN)

Physical Requirements:

  • Requires full range of body motion including handling and lifting patient, manual and finger dexterity, and eye-hand coordination.

  • Requires standing and walking for extended periods of time.

  • Requires corrected vision and hearing to normal range.

  • Requires working under stressful conditions and irregular hours.

  • Exposure to communicable diseases and/or body fluids.

  • Medium Work - Exerting 20 to 50 pounds of force occasionally, and/or 10 to 25 pounds of force frequently, and/or greater than negligible up to 10 pounds of force constantly to move objects.

  • Physical Demand requirements are in excess of those for Light Work.

Personal Protective Equipment:

  • Follows standard precautions using personal protective equipment as required.
